freeCodeCamp/curriculum/challenges/spanish/03-front-end-libraries/react-and-redux/moving-forward-from-here.sp...

72 lines
2.6 KiB
Markdown
Raw Normal View History

2018-10-08 17:34:43 +00:00
---
id: 5a24c314108439a4d403614a
title: Moving Forward From Here
challengeType: 6
isRequired: false
2018-10-10 20:20:40 +00:00
videoUrl: ''
localeTitle: Avanzando desde aquí
2018-10-08 17:34:43 +00:00
---
## Description
2018-10-10 20:20:40 +00:00
<section id="description"> ¡Felicidades! Terminaste las lecciones sobre React y Redux. Hay un último elemento que vale la pena señalar antes de continuar. Normalmente, no escribirás aplicaciones React en un editor de código como este. Este desafío le da una idea de cómo se ve la sintaxis si está trabajando con npm y un sistema de archivos en su propia máquina. El código debe tener un aspecto similar, excepto por el uso de instrucciones de <code>import</code> (estos detienen todas las dependencias que se le proporcionaron en los desafíos). La sección &quot;Administración de paquetes con npm&quot; cubre npm con más detalle. Finalmente, escribir el código React y Redux generalmente requiere alguna configuración. Esto puede complicarse rápidamente. Si está interesado en experimentar en su propia máquina, la <a id="CRA" target="_blank" href="https://github.com/facebookincubator/create-react-app">aplicación Create React</a> viene configurada y lista para funcionar. Alternativamente, puede habilitar Babel como un preprocesador de JavaScript en CodePen, agregar React y ReactDOM como recursos externos de JavaScript, y trabajar allí también. </section>
2018-10-08 17:34:43 +00:00
## Instructions
2018-10-10 20:20:40 +00:00
<section id="instructions"> Registre el mensaje <code>&#39;Now I know React and Redux!&#39;</code> a la consola. </section>
2018-10-08 17:34:43 +00:00
## Tests
<section id='tests'>
```yml
tests:
- text: El mensaje ¡ <code>Now I know React and Redux!</code> debe estar registrado en la consola.
testString: 'assert(editor.getValue().includes("console.log("Now I know React and Redux!")") || editor.getValue().includes("console.log(\"Now I know React and Redux!\")"), "The message <code>Now I know React and Redux!</code> should be logged to the console.");'
```
</section>
## Challenge Seed
<section id='challengeSeed'>
<div id='jsx-seed'>
```jsx
// import React from 'react'
// import ReactDOM from 'react-dom'
// import { Provider, connect } from 'react-redux'
// import { createStore, combineReducers, applyMiddleware } from 'redux'
// import thunk from 'redux-thunk'
// import rootReducer from './redux/reducers'
// import App from './components/App'
// const store = createStore(
// rootReducer,
// applyMiddleware(thunk)
// );
// ReactDOM.render(
// <Provider store={store}>
// <App/>
// </Provider>,
// document.getElementById('root')
// );
// change code below this line
```
</div>
</section>
## Solution
<section id='solution'>
```js
2018-10-10 20:20:40 +00:00
// solution required
2018-10-08 17:34:43 +00:00
```
</section>